Centos6.5 安装nginx-1.9.9

1、准备环境

1.1 系统平台:CentOS release 6.6 (Final) 64位。

cat /etc/redhat-release

1. 2 安装编译工具及库文件

说明:
安装nginx编译环境:gcc-c++
安装pcre库解析正则:pcre pcre-devel
安装zlib库用于压缩解压缩: zlib zlib-devel
安装openssl库:openssl openssl-devel

yum -y install make zlib zlib-devel gcc-c++ libtool  openssl openssl-devel

1.3 首先要安装 PCRE

PCRE 作用是让 Nginx 支持 Rewrite 功能。

1.3.1 下载 PCRE 安装包

下载地址: http://downloads.sourceforge.net/project/pcre/pcre/8.35/pcre-8.35.tar.gz

1.3.2 上传

上传pcre-8.35.tar.gz到指定目录/opt/software下
在这里插入图片描述

1.3.3 解压安装包

将pcre-8.35.tar.gz解压到指定目录/opt/module

tar -zxvf pcre-8.35.tar.gz -C /opt/module/

在这里插入图片描述

1.3.4 进入安装包目录
cd pcre-8.35/
1.3.5 编译安装
[root@node5 pcre-8.35]# ./configure
[root@node5 pcre-8.35]# make && make install
1.3.6 查看pcre版本
[root@node5 pcre-8.35]# pcre-config --version

在这里插入图片描述

2 安装 Nginx

2.1下载 Nginx&上传

下载地址:http://nginx.org/download/nginx-1.9.9.tar.gz
上传nginx-1.9.9.tar.gz 到指定目录/opt/software下
在这里插入图片描述

2.2 解压安装包

将nginx-1.9.9.tar.gz解压到指定目录/opt/module

[root@node5 software]# tar -zxvf nginx-1.9.9.tar.gz -C /opt/module

2.3 进入安装包目录

[root@node5 software]# cd /opt/module/nginx-1.9.9/

2.4 编译安装

源码的安装一般由3个步骤组成:配置(configure)、编译(make)、安装(make install)

   我们都知道源码包安装分为这么几个阶段,
1、  tar:解压这个源码软件包。
2、  cd:进入到这个源码包。
3、  ./configure:“configure”会在你的系统上测试存在的特性(或者bug!)然后来建立Makefile文件来完成make!
4、  make:编译程序。
5、  make install:安装文件
./configure --prefix=/usr/local/nginx  --with-pcre=/opt/module/pcre-8.35

说明: 安装说明参考 https://www.cnblogs.com/tudachui/p/9546011.html

./configure --prefix=/软件要安装的路径

2.5 查看nginx版本

[root@node5 nginx-1.9.9]# /usr/local/nginx/sbin/nginx -v
nginx version: nginx/1.9.9

启动

usr/local/nginx/sbin/nginx

检查是否启动成功:

打开浏览器访问此机器的 IP,如果浏览器出现 Welcome to nginx! 则表示 Nginx 已经安装并运行成功。
http://ip/
在这里插入图片描述

部分命令如下:

重启:
/usr/local/nginx/sbin/nginx –s reload
停止:
 /usr/local/nginx/sbin/nginx –s stop
测试配置文件是否正常:
/usr/local/nginx/sbin/nginx –t
强制关闭
[root@node5 sbin]# ps -ef|grep nginx
kill -9 16161

在这里插入图片描述

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值